Output 07e1fc659d0b163787fec9fa2a6ce020abcd5eb4a9bdc6d09ae25f2107e67a6e:0

value
592870
script pubkey
OP_0 OP_PUSHBYTES_32 f59af553e5c793a8b48e6bbda3f05c16d1f4a3dcc619c7eff4489feb11749af4
address
bc1q7kd025l9c7f63dywdw768uzuzmglfg7uccvu0ml5fz07kyt5nt6qlxqwdx
transaction
07e1fc659d0b163787fec9fa2a6ce020abcd5eb4a9bdc6d09ae25f2107e67a6e
confirmations
136295
spent
true